Fred Lewis Newman, age 65, of Lake Station passed away Saturday June 17, 2023, in his home. He was born December 28, 1957, in Gary, Indiana to the late Lewis and Genevieve (Parr) Newman. Fred retired from directing and producing local cable programing for Cable Networks. He was very active in Lake Station politics and events. He was very active with the Four Girls Project, even helping to establish the Four Girls Scholarship Fund. He loved photography of the Lake Station area even though he was considered legally blind. He enjoyed Ham Radio; he also was a former member of a Morse Code Club. He loved music, especially Neil Young. Fred had a well-developed sense of humor which he was never afraid to share.

He is survived by the love of his life Marsha Moore; one sister, Virginia Adams of Kentucky; two nieces; four nephews; eight great nieces and nephews; four great-great nieces and nephews; special life-long friends, the Bianco Family including Tony Bianco. He also loved his dogs Streaker and Cloe.

He was preceded in death by his parents; one sister, Cynthia Cathcart; and two brothers-in-law.

Fred wished to be cremated. A celebration of his life will be held at a later date.
